Rajasthan is preparing for elections in many local city and town wards.

More than 10,000 candidates withdrew from the race before the deadline.

This left 38,891 candidates competing for 10,245 wards.

Some withdrawals caused arguments between supporters of different parties.

In one case, a candidate reportedly joined the BJP after withdrawing.

In another case, Congress workers said police and officials acted unfairly during a dispute.

An independent candidate alleged that he was offered Rs 1 lakh to leave the race, and police seized the money.

These allegations still need to be investigated and proved.

At least 77 candidates were elected without a contest because their opponents withdrew.

Key facts

Candidates remaining
38,891 candidates remain after withdrawals.
Withdrawals
10,112 candidates withdrew nominations.
Civic bodies
The elections cover 309 civic bodies.
Wards
There are 10,245 wards in the contests.
Rejected nominations
More than 17,000 nomination papers were rejected during scrutiny.
Unopposed candidates
At least 77 candidates were elected unopposed.
Alleged inducement
Independent candidate Rohit Sen alleged that Rs 1 lakh was offered for his withdrawal; police seized the money.
